What is Fifteen more than half a number is 9.
BARSIC [14]

So we'll assume the number is x.

So,

15+\frac{x}{2}= 9.

Now, we solve for x:

\frac{x}{2}= 9-15

\frac{x}{2}= -6

x = -6*2

x = -12


Check work:

15+\frac{-12}{2}= 9

15+(-6) = 9

15-6 = 9

9 = 9
